4     /** \class ShallowTree
5     *
6     * Makes a tree out of C++ standard types and vectors of C++ standard types
7     *
8     * This class, which is an EDAnalyzer, takes the same "keep" and
9     * "drop" outputCommands parameter as the PoolOutputSource, making a
10     * tree of the selected variables, which it obtains from the EDM
11     * tree.
12     *
13     * See the file python/test_cfg.py for an example configuration.
14     *
15     * See the file doc/README for more detailed documentation, including
16     * advantages, disadvantages, and use philosophy.
17     *
